Copenhagen's North Sea location makes it mild and windy year-round. Summers are pleasant but cool; winters are cold and dark. The city is famous for year-round cycling culture and outdoor life that continues regardless of weather.

Milan

Milan sits in the western Po Valley, one of Europe's most fog-prone and humidity-trapping basins, hemmed in by the Alps to the north and the Apennines to the south. The city experiences hot, humid summers with weak ventilation and cold, damp winters where temperature inversions trap pollution and moisture at ground level. The Navigli canal system and proximity to several pre-Alpine lakes introduce subtle moisture gradients, while the dense urban core generates one of Italy's strongest urban heat island effects.
